I might have just topped my previous crash, this time with one of my all time favorites, my Flying Styro Kit Mosquito. I was filming air-to-air footage with a quad, and just got too slow. She dropped a tip and disappeared into the forest. 4 days of searching later, I found it. There wasn't much left, it went down in a thorn bush that acted like a giant paper shredder. 3mm depron doesn't take a hit nearly as nicely as epo, she will be missed..2 Photos

I'm flying my P-38 (today ) Been in the air for several minutes. Noticed I hadn't connected my neck strap to my transmitter. Reached with one hand to connect. Connected it and heard my transmitter make some familiar tones.....THE TONES IT MAKES WHEN TURNING THE POWER OFF!!!!! YIKES! !#$@@!# No, not in time, power on.1 PhotoLon
